Dr. Fu receives award to support his lymphoma research

Kai Fu, M.D., Ph.D., associate professor of pathology and microbiology, has received the 2009 Millennium Pharmaceuticals, Inc./Lymphoma Research Foundation Clinical Investigator Career Development Award.

Trade Commission to investigate ‘knock-offs’ of UNMC creatine product

An investigation into nutraceutical products falsely advertised as containing raw creatine ethyl ester, a creatine pronutrient with increased solubility, was initiated earlier this summer in an effort to protect a UNMC invention and consumer confidence in a dietary supplement.

Burger King campaign to again benefit cancer research

For the sixth consecutive year, participating Burger King restaurants in Omaha and the surrounding areas will raise money for pediatric cancer research at the UNMC Eppley Cancer Center.
